48-year-old Robert Britton was arrested and jailed on arson charges on August 10, 2025, after he allegedly set a room on fire at Coffee Regional Medical Center.
According to a report from the Douglas Police Department, an officer responded to the hospital around 11:30 p.m. to assist emergency room staff with placing Britton into a room. Once he was in the room and secure, the police officer left.
The report says that the officer was standing outside behind the hospital when he heard a fire alarm go off. He went back into the emergency room and saw smoke coming from Britton’s room. Staff said that at 11:30 p.m., a nurse was looking at the cameras and saw flames in Britton’s room. She immediately picked up a fire extinguisher and put out the flames. The mattress and bed covers were burned.
When asked why he set the room on fire, the report says that Britton responded by stating that “no one listened to him.” Britton was arrested and transported to the Coffee County Jail. He was charged with arson in the 1st degree. Britton remains incarcerated.
